Bobi Wine To Address Ugandans Today

1 Mins read

National Unity Platform president, and 2021 Presidential election loser Robert Ssentamu Kyagulanyi famously knowns as Bobi Wine has said that he will address Ugandans today at 5pm.

“Greetings fellow Ugandans. Today at 5PM, I will be addressing you live here on Facebook,” said Bobi Wine in a Facebook post.

Bobi Wine has not been allowed to leave his home for the past 9days and his home in Magere home is being guarded by police and other security forces.

In the 9 days of home arrest, Bobi Wine has only been allowed to be visited by his lawyers who in the past days filed a petition in high court challenging his deprived freedom of movement.

“Today at around 3.30PM, a total of 8 lawyers led by Hon. Asuman Basalirwa, who form part of Hon.Kyagulanyi’s legal team, visited him at his home in Magere. They in addition carried food items and essential commodities for the family, in supplement to the daily purchases.

We continue to maintain our preventive action and cover in the area, as we await the outcome of the writ of Habeas Corpus, before the High Court in Kampala,” said ASP Luke Owoyesigyire the

Kampala Metropolitan Police Deputy PRO.

Bobi Wine rejected the 2021 election results citing that they were rigged.

Museveni polled 5,851,037 votes, representing 58.64% of the 9,978,093 valid votes.

Robert Kyagulanyi aka Bobi Wine had of 3,475,298 votes (34.83%)
